Project Promoter: Polska Fundacja Dzieci i Młodzieży
Grant amount: 113 306,68 EUR
Partners: Newschool AS (Norway)
Duration: 01.10.2022-31.03.2024
The aim of the project is to engage 600 young people, vocational schools' students in the Mazovian and Lublin provinces, in shaping local environmental protection programmes. Groups of young people develop solutions to local environmental problems and present them as prototypes, models and concepts, which will be later showcast during public presentations and meetings to summarise the project.

Project Promoter: Stowarzyszenie Centrum Wspierania Organizacji Pozarządowych i Inicjatyw Obywatelskich
Call: 2nd thematic call
Grant amount: 102 448,83 EUR
Partners: None
Duration: 01.10.2022-30.04.2024
In this project, we engage 300 residents of the Warmian-Masurian Province in civic activities. We prepare them to implement local initiatives, co-create with them development strategies of their communities, teach them how to manage an NGO and reinforce the need for participation. As part of the project, we are implementing two educational cycles for community animators and local leaders. Participants receive animation, educational, advisory and coaching support.

Project Promoter: Stowarzyszenie Pomocy Potrzebującym NADZIEJA
Call: 2nd thematic call
Grant amount: 69 252,37 EUR
Partners: None
Duration: 01.10.2022-01.10.2023
The challenge addressed by this project is the lack of coordinated activities carried out in the Serock Municipality for people aged over 60 years. There is a lack of solutions developed by older people themselves, who are not involved in shaping local policies. The aim of the project is to create a coherent Strategy for the activities of the Serock Municipality for seniors over 60 years for 2023-2027, which will be adopted for implementation by the Council of the Municipality.

Project Promoter: Fundacja Laboratorium Zmiany
Call: 2nd thematic call
Grant amount: 102 405,37 EUR
Partners: Stowarzyszenie Europa Iuvenis
Duration: 01.10.2022-30.04.2024
The aim of the project is to raise awareness of gender discrimination in local authorities in the Opole and Lower Silesia Provinces and to prevent such discrimination. As part of the project, we are conducting research and preparing a report on the forms and effects of gender discrimination. We are implementing an educational campaign addressed to local governments. We organise ‘circles’ – cyclical meetings for local women leaders.

Project Promoter: 9dwunastych
Call: 2nd thematic call
Grant amount: 101 818,36 EUR
Partners: Stowarzyszenie Egala
Duration: 01.10.2022-29.02.2024
We address the project to people who have an impact on the worldview of young people and adults: activists, people working in education, culture and public institutions, local governments as well as people who publish on social media and on Wikipedia. Our aim is to give those people the skills to present human rights attractively as a valuable basis for building a worldview and to implement anti-discrimination education as a horizontal standard for their activities.

Project Promoter: Fundacja Bliżej Pasji
Call: 2nd thematic call
Grant amount: 74 934,65 EUR
Partners:
Biłgoraj EKO Challenge
The Biłgoraj Municipality
Skawina Town and Municipality Office
Duration: 01.11.2022-30.04.2024
As part of the project, we carry out civic workshops, study visits and run a social campaign. We carry out a diagnosis of the state of the environment in the municipality and organise open meetings with residents about ecology. We carry out civic initiatives and jointly develop decisions on solutions that will improve local policy on keeping the environment in the Biłgoraj Municipality clean.
